Delete Number from the Call list
1 Select number from Call list.
2 Press the Soft key "More".
3 Select Delete".
4 Select "Yes" to delete the entry from the list.
Delete All Entries from the Call List
1 Select number from Call list.
2 Press the Soft key "More".
3 Select "Delete all".
4 Select "Yes" to delete all the entries from the list.
7.1.2 Missed Calls
1 Select Missed calls, and step with the to scroll in the list.
2 Press the Soft key "Call" to call back.
As in Call List there is a Soft key "More" where it is possible to view the time/date of the
call, edit the received number, add to contacts, delete received numbers. See 7.1.1 Call List
on page 26 for information about the same functionality in Soft key "More".
7.1.3 Call Time
The total time of the previous call and last call is displayed.
1 Select Call time.
2 Press "Back" to return to the Calls menu, or Hook on key to return to the idle view.

Absence Handling
The reason for being absent, and the return time can be specified here.
1 Step to the Call services menu with the and press the Soft key "Select".
2 Select Absence with the and press the Soft key "Select".
If the cordless telephone is preprogrammed a number of absence reasons can be
displayed, for example “Lunch”, “Meeting”, “Trip” etc. Press "Select", enter time or date,
press "OK".
Deactivate the absence setting
1 Enter “Call service” in the menu and select “Deactivate”. Press Select".
